Three Trees
Three Trees is a wet, wild and calligraphic watercolor painting of three aspen trees on a slope; a classic Colorado landscape scene, depicted in vivid colors. Autumnal yellow leaves crown these white barked trees, but high in the sky, as I didn’t precisely want them to be the main focus, the way they (rightfully) are in so many paintings. I especially love how the waxy white bark picks up other, surrounding colors, in certain lights, and the dark scarring, eyes and knobby growths that show me how the tree has really lived, and seen so much that I can only guess at.
*****
For this painting, I chose to experiment with working on hot press watercolor paper, which has a much smoother texture than the cold press I customarily use, and which I find to offer major differences in how the plaint flows, blends, absorbs and dries.
